Description

  • Kurt Schwitters
  • Merzzeichnung 47 (Merz drawing 47)
  • signed K. Schwitters, dated 1920, and titled on the artist's mount
  • collage on board
  • image size: 10.6 by 8.3cm., 4 1/8 by 3 1/4 in.
  • sheet size (visible): 13 by 10.5cm., 5 1/8 by 4 1/8 in.

Provenance

Evert Rinsema, Assen (Dutch poet and intellectual)
Thijs Rinsema, Assen (brother of the above, possibly by descent and until 1955)
Walter van Aggelen (a gift from the above, circa 1955)
Frits van Aggelen, Appeldoorn (probably acquired by circa 1995)
Acquired from the above by the present owner

Exhibited

Franeker, Museum 't Coopmanshuis & The Hague, Haags Gemeentemuseum, Holland Dada / Holland Dada. Paul Citroen en het Bauhaus, 1974 (possibly)
Leeuwarden, Fries Museum; Dordrecht, Dordrecht Museum & Roermond, Museum H. Luyten - Dr Cuijpers, Thijs Rinsema, 1980, no. 2, illustrated in colour in the catalogue

Literature

Karin Orchard & Isabel Schulz (eds.), Kurt Schwitters, Catalogue raisonné 1905-22, Hanover, 2000, no. 629, illustrated p. 288

Condition

The board is stable and the collage elements are secure. The board is slightly warped, relating to the application of the collage elements. The artist's mount is time stained and there is a small tear towards the lower left corner, barely visible. This work is in good original condition.
